Project Manager (Toronto)
We are: A growing web agency located in Liberty Village, full of super talented, smart, nice people. Our handful of developers and designers work independently on a high volume of diverse client work, in an agile, fast-paced environment. Projects vary from fun, creative microsites, to large scale web and mobile (iPhone/iPad) applications. Our small company works with one of Canada's largest telecommunications companies, a major global publishing company, and one of the nation's largest insurance and financial services providers. We also work with a few great start-ups. Our clients appreciate our expediency, the quality of our work, and the ideas we bring to the table.
You are: A super talented, smart, nice person. You are a strong manager with a diverse background in the online world. You may have worked as a project manager or coordinator, web marketer, designer, writer, or developer.
You're probably reading this because you need more of a challenge, or you feel like all of your talent is being stifled in a team filled with managers who don't quite "get" the online world. You want to work with smarter, better web people who support you and deliver the project with outstanding results. You love working directly with clients, coming up with solutions for complex marketing and e-commerce challenges. You want ownership on projects and love the challenge of managing timelines and resources. You want to enjoy what you do, where you do it, and go home with a sense of pride in your work.
We're looking for someone with:
Strong project management and coordination skills; you will need to make sense of projects with few requirements and little direction provided.
Good sense of user experience; you can put together sketches or convey concepts to a project team or client with ease.
Excellent communication skills; you will be talking directly to our clients, and also managing our project teams. You speak client, and geek.
The ability to multitask; you'll likely wear a few different hats across projects. You may have to write copy, be an art director, be an analyst, be a babysitter.
Client-facing skills and strong leadership and management abilities; you can say 'no' to a client but make it seem like you're saying 'yes'.
Process and workflow mastery; you recognize process problems and strive to create solutions to help our team and our clients to work better together.
Fluency in Spanish would be ideal.
